核心结论:使用M浏览器下载网页视频,无需安装第三方工具、无需开启开发者模式、无需复杂操作,即可轻松实现。然而许多用户常常卡壳——要么入口选错,要么关键开关未开启,导致刷新多次依然找不到下载按钮。
实际上,M浏览器内置了m3u8地址抓取与审查元素功能,只是开关位置较为隐蔽。接下来将详细解析四种可行方法。

确认M浏览器已开启视频下载权限(必须设置)
打开M浏览器,点击右下角「≡」菜单,进入「设置」,找到「高级功能」,开启「视频下载支持」开关。这一步至关重要,否则后续所有操作均无效。该开关默认关闭,未开启时下载图标不会出现——它并非控制UI显示,而是底层流媒体解析能力的总开关。
直接下载MP4/WebM直链视频——一步到位的方法
播放目标视频,在画面任意位置长按两秒,弹出悬浮菜单后点击「下载视频」即可。对于.mp4、.webm等直链视频,操作最为简便,文件将自动保存至「M浏览器/Download/Video」目录,无需手动查找。
抓取m3u8地址并下载——适用于B站、小红书、知乎等平台
第一步:播放视频后,点击地址栏右侧「?」图标,选择「审查元素」,切换到「Network」标签页。
第二步:在Filter框中输入「m3u8」,重新播放视频以触发请求。找到类型为「application/vnd.apple.mpegurl」的条目,长按并选择「复制链接」。
第三步:返回首页,点击底部「下载」标签,点击右上角「+」号,粘贴复制的m3u8链接,点击「开始下载」即可。M浏览器内置合并功能,无需手动使用ffmpeg。
注意:部分网站会对m3u8添加Referer或时间戳校验。若提示“下载失败”,可在审查页面右键该m3u8请求,选择「Copy as cURL」,在终端中执行curl命令验证链接有效性,然后重试。
使用猫抓插件增强嗅探能力——可选进阶方案
方法一:在M浏览器中访问catcatcher.net官网,下载Cat Catcher APK,安装后重启M浏览器,插件图标将自动出现在地址栏右侧。播放视频时点击该图标,勾选「Media」标签下的目标资源,点击「Download」即可。
方法二:若插件无响应,进入M浏览器「设置」→「扩展管理」,手动启用「Cat Catcher」并授予「读取网页内容」权限。
猫抓插件擅长捕获JS动态生成的分片地址,对抖音网页版、微博嵌入视频成功率较高。但需要额外安装APK,不属于纯原生方案。
从缓存提取已加载视频——应急备用方法
将视频完整播放一遍后,返回M浏览器首页,点击「下载」,切换到底部的「缓存视频」标签。系统将自动扫描最近播放过的完整视频文件,找到对应条目后,点击「保存到相册」即可。
注意:该功能仅对未加密的MP4有效,HLS流或AES加密视频不会显示在此列表中。
